How the OSTP reports it

Oklahoma’s OSTP math is built on the 2022 Oklahoma Academic Standards for Mathematics rather than a national shared blueprint. The state math standards page notes that Statistics & Probability and Precalculus were added in the 2022 revision, and Precalculus includes a Trigonometry strand.

A substance has a half-life of 55 years. What fraction remains after 1010 years?

10÷5=210 \div 5 = 2 half-lives. Remaining: (12)2=14\left(\dfrac{1}{2}\right)^{2} = \dfrac{1}{4}.

The inverse of f(x)=3x1f(x)=\dfrac{3}{x-1} is

Set y=3x1y=\dfrac{3}{x-1}. Swap: x=3y1x=\dfrac{3}{y-1}. Multiply: x(y1)=3x(y-1)=3. Divide by xx: y1=3xy-1=\dfrac{3}{x}. Add 11: y=3x+1y=\dfrac{3}{x}+1. So f1(x)=3x+1.f^{-1}(x)=\dfrac{3}{x}+1\textsf{.}

Which of the following describes the transformation from the graph of f(x)f(x) to the graph of y=f(x)y = -f(x)?

Multiplying the outputs by 1-1 replaces each yy-value with its opposite, which reflects the graph over the xx-axis.
